Trends Shaping the Future of Fabrication Companies:

  1. Automation and Robotics: One of the most transformative trends reshaping fabrication companies is the fusion of automation and robotics. This integration significantly streamlines operations, amplifying the precision and efficiency of manufacturing various components. By employing robots empowered with cutting-edge software, these companies can execute intricate tasks with unparalleled accuracy. This heightened level of automation not only amplifies productivity but also plays a pivotal role in curbing human errors, thereby elevating the overall quality and reliability of fabricated products.

  2. Additive Manufacturing (3D Printing): The emergence of additive manufacturing, notably 3D printing, is reshaping the conventional fabrication scene. This transformative technology constructs intricate structures layer by layer, providing unparalleled design flexibility while curbing material wastage. Companies that integrate 3D printing witness accelerated prototyping at reduced costs, thereby revolutionizing manufacturing methods. This innovation allows for swift, cost-effective prototype production, fundamentally altering the dynamics of the manufacturing process. As a result, the adoption of 3D printing marks a pivotal shift in the traditional approaches of fabrication companies.

  3. Internet of Things (IoT) Integration: The integration of the Internet of Things (IoT) stands as a pivotal trend within the fabrication industry. By integrating IoT, machines, and equipment are empowered to facilitate real-time monitoring, predictive maintenance, and data-driven decision-making. This connectivity ensures seamless operations, minimizing downtime, and significantly enhancing overall efficiency within fabrication facilities. Through the utilization of IoT-enabled systems, fabricators can actively monitor equipment performance, swiftly identify issues, and make informed decisions, thereby optimizing productivity and fostering a more agile working environment.

  4. Advanced Materials and Sustainable Practices: Fabrication companies are progressively delving into innovative materials and incorporating eco-conscious methods. These advanced materials boost durability, lightness, and eco-friendliness. By embracing sustainable practices like recycling and waste reduction, these companies align their operations with environmental objectives while maximizing resource efficiency. This shift towards sustainability not only benefits the environment but also enhances the overall ethos of the fabrication industry, ensuring a more responsible and conscientious approach to manufacturing processes.

Technologies Driving Transformation:

  1. Computer-Aided Design (CAD) and Simulation: CAD plays pivotal roles in modern fabrication. CAD software enables meticulous design and visualization of components, aiding in meticulous planning before fabrication begins. These tools offer a virtual canvas, allowing intricate detailing and precise measurements, thereby minimizing errors and enhancing accuracy. Moreover, Simulation tools are instrumental in evaluating structural integrity and performance virtually. By simulating real-world conditions, companies can identify potential issues, cutting down on the necessity for physical prototypes, thus accelerating the development cycle significantly.

  2. Artificial Intelligence (AI) in Manufacturing: Artificial Intelligence (AI) has emerged as a game-changer in manufacturing for fabrication companies. Through cutting-edge predictive analytics and machine learning algorithms, AI meticulously analyzes extensive datasets. This analysis serves to elevate operational efficiency, bolster predictive maintenance strategies, and refine quality control measures. AI's integration into the manufacturing realm has propelled these companies into a realm of heightened precision and foresight, enabling them to optimize their processes and maintain superior quality standards.

  3. Augmented Reality (AR) for Training and Prototyping: AR technology has emerged as a game-changer for fabrication companies. Through AR technology, workers experience immersive training sessions, gaining hands-on knowledge in a simulated environment. Moreover, AR aids in prototyping by seamlessly integrating digital models into the real-world setting. This innovation accelerates prototyping, enabling companies to iterate and refine designs. Consequently, leveraging AR not only enhances training methodologies but also expedites the development cycle, empowering fabrication companies to stay ahead in an ever-evolving industry.
